CREDIT AGREEMENT
Dated as of February 27, 2015
EMC CORPORATION, a Massachusetts corporation (the “Borrower”), the lenders from time to time party hereto and issuers of letters of credit from time to time party hereto, and CITIBANK, N.A. (“Citibank”), as administrative agent (the “Agent”) for the Lenders (as hereinafter defined), agree as follows:

ARTICLE I
DEFINITIONS AND ACCOUNTING TERMS
SECTION 1.01. Certain Defined Terms. As used in this Agreement, the following terms shall have the following meanings (such meanings to be equally applicable to both the singular and plural forms of the terms defined):
Administrative Questionnaire” means an Administrative Questionnaire in a form supplied by the Agent.
Advance” means an advance by a Lender to the Borrower as part of a Borrowing and refers to a Base Rate Advance or a Eurodollar Rate Advance (each of which shall be a “Type” of Advance).
Affiliate” means, with respect to a specified Person, another Person that directly, or indirectly through one or more intermediaries, Controls or is Controlled by or is under common Control with the Person specified.
Agent’s Account” means the account of the Agent maintained by the Agent at Citibank at its office at 1615 Brett Road, Building #3, New Castle, Delaware 19720, Account No. 36852248, Attention: Bank Loan Syndications.
Anniversary Date” has the meaning specified in Section 2.22(a).
Anti-Corruption Laws” means all laws, rules, and regulations of any jurisdiction applicable to the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ries from time to time concerning or relating to bribery or corruption, including without limitation the Foreign Corrupt Practices Act of 1977.

Applicable Lending Office” means, with respect to each Lender, such Lender’s Domestic Lending Office in the case of a Base Rate Advance and such Lender’s Eurodollar Lending Office in the case of a Eurodollar Rate Advance.

ARTICLE II
AMOUNTS AND TERMS OF THE ADVANCES AND LETTERS OF CREDIT
SECTION 2.01. The Advances and Letters of Credit . (a) Advances. Each Lender severally agrees, on the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th, to make Advances in US dollars to the Borrower from time to time on any Business Day during the period from the Effective Date until the Termination Date applicable to such Lender in an aggregate principal amount not to exceed such Lender’s Unused Commitment. Each Borrowing shall be in an aggregate amount of $10,000,000 or an integral multiple of $1,000,000 in excess thereof and shall consist of Advances of the same Type made on the same day by the Lenders ratably according to their respective Revolving Credit Commitments. Within the limits of each Lender’s Revolving Credit Commitment, the Borrower may borrow under this Section 2.01, prepay pursuant to Section 2.10 and reborrow under this Section 2.01.
(b)    Letters of Credit. Each Issuing Bank agrees, on the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th, in reliance upon the agreements of the other Lenders set forth in this Agreement, to issue letters of credit (each, a “Letter of Credit”) denominated in US dollars for the account of the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ries from time to time on any Business Day during the period from the Effective Date until 30 days before the Termination Date in an aggregate Available Amount (i) for all Letters of Credit issued by each Issuing Bank not to exceed at any time the lesser of (x) the Letter of Credit Sub-Facility at such time and (y) such Issuing Bank’s Letter of Credit Commitment at such time and (ii) for each such Letter of Credit not to exceed an amount equal to the Unused Commitments of the Lenders at such time. No Letter of Credit shall have an expiration date (including all rights of the Borrower or the beneficiary to require renewal) later than 10 Business Days before the latest Termination Date, provided that no Letter of Credit may expire after the Termination Date of any Non-Consenting Lender if, after giving effect to such issuance, the aggregate Revolving Credit Commitments of the Consenting Lenders (including any replacement Lenders) for the period following such Termination Date would be less than the Available Amount of the Letters of Credit expiring after such Termination Date. Within the limits referred to above, the Borrower may from time to time request the issuance of Letters of Credit under this Section 2.01(b).
SECTION 2.02. Making the Advances. (a) Each Borrowing shall be made on notice, given not later than (x) 11:00 A.M. (New York City time) on the third Business Day prior to the date of the proposed Borrowing in the case of a Borrowing consisting of Eurodollar Rate Advances or (y) 11:00 A.M. (New York City time) on the date of the proposed Borrowing in the case of a Borrowing consisting of Base Rate Advances, by the Borrower to the Agent, which shall give to each Lender prompt notice thereof by telecopier. Each such notice of a Borrowing (a “Notice of Borrowing”) shall be given by telecopier or telephone, confirmed promptly in writing, in substantially the form of Exhibit B hereto (in the case of written notices), specifying therein the requested (i) date of such Borrowing, (ii) Type of Advances comprising such Borrowing, (iii) aggregate amount of such Borrowing, and (iv) in the case of a Borrowing consisting of Eurodollar Rate Advances, initial Interest Period for each such Advance. Each Lender shall, before 1:00 P.M. (New York City time) on the date of such Borrowing, make available for the account of its Applicable Lending Office to the Agent at the Agent’s Account, in same day funds, such Lender’s ratable portion of such Borrowing. After the Agent’s receipt of such funds and upon fulfillment of the applicable conditions set forth in Article III, the Agent will make such funds available to the Borrower either by (i) crediting the account of the Borrower at the Agent’s address referred to in Section 8.02 or (ii) wire transfer of such funds, in each case as designated by the Borrower.
(b)    Anything in subsection (a) above to the contrary notwithstanding, (i) the Borrower may not select Eurodollar Rate Advances for any Borrowing if the aggregate amount of such Borrowing is less than $10,000,000 or if the obligation of the Lenders to make Eurodollar Rate Advances

21



shall then be suspended pursuant to Section 2.08 or 2.12 and (ii) the Eurodollar Rate Advances may not be outstanding as part of more than six separate Borrowings.
(c)    Unless the Agent shall have received notice from a Lender (x) in the case of Base Rate Advances, one hour prior to the proposed time of such Borrowing and (y) otherwise, prior to the proposed date of any Borrowing that such Lender will not make available to the Agent such Lender’s share of such Borrowing, the Agent may assume that such Lender has made such share available on such date in accordance with subsection (a) of this Section 2.02 and may, in reliance upon such assumption, make available to the Borrower a corresponding amount. In such event, if a Lender has not in fact made its share of the applicable Borrowing available to the Agent, then the applicable Lender and the Borrower severally agree to pay to the Agent forthwith on demand such corresponding amount with interest thereon, for each day from and including the date such amount is made available to the Borrower to but excluding the date of payment to the Agent, at (i) in the case of a payment to be made by such Lender, the greater of the Federal Funds Effective Rate and a rate determined by the Agent in accordance with banking industry rules on interbank compensation, and (ii) in the case of a payment to be made by the Borrower, the interest rate applicable to Base Rate Advances. If the Borrower and such Lender shall pay such interest to the Agent for the same or an overlapping period, the Agent shall promptly remit to the Borrower the amount of such interest paid by the Borrower for such period. If such Lender pays its share of the applicable Borrowing to the Agent, then the amount so paid shall constitute such Lender’s Advance included in such Borrowing. Any payment by the Borrower shall be without prejudice to any claim the Borrower may have against a Lender that shall have failed to make such payment to the Agent.
(d)    The obligations of the Lenders hereunder to make Advances and to make payments pursuant to Section 8.04(c) are several and not joint. The failure of any Lender to make any Advance or to make any payment under Section 8.04(c) on any date required hereunder shall not relieve any other Lender of its corresponding obligation to do so on such date, and no Lender shall be responsible for the failure of any other Lender to so make its Advance or to make its payment under Section 8.04(c).

SECTION 2.07. Interest on Advances. (a) Scheduled Interest. The Borrower shall pay interest on the unpaid principal amount of each Advance owing to each Lender from the date of such Advance until such principal amount shall be paid in full, at the following rates per annum:
(i)    Base Rate Advances. During such periods as such Advance is a Base Rate Advance, a rate per annum equal at all times to the sum of (x) the Base Rate in effect from time to time plus (y) the Applicable Margin in effect from time to time, payable in arrears quarterly on the last day of each March, June, September and December during such periods and on the date such Base Rate Advance shall be Converted or paid in full.
(ii)    Eurodollar Rate Advances. During such periods as such Advance is a Eurodollar Rate Advance, a rate per annum equal at all times during each Interest Period for such Advance to the sum of (x) the Eurodollar Rate for such Interest Period for such Advance plus (y) the Applicable Margin in effect from time to time, payable in arrears on the last day of such Interest Period and, if such Interest Period has a duration of more than three months, on each day that occurs during such Interest Period every three months from the first day of such Interest Period and on the date such Eurodollar Rate Advance shall be Converted or paid in full.
(b)    Default Interest. Upon the occurrence and during the continuance of an Event of Default under Section 6.01(a), the Agent shall at the request, or may with the consent, of the Required

26



Lenders, require the Borrower to pay interest (“Default Interest”) on (i) the unpaid principal amount of each Advance owing to each Lender that is not paid when due, payable in arrears on the dates referred to in clause (a)(i) or (a)(ii) above, at a rate per annum equal at all times to 2% per annum above the rate per annum required to be paid on such Advance pursuant to clause (a)(i) or (a)(ii) above and (ii) to the fullest extent permitted by law, the amount of any interest, fee or other amount payable hereunder that is not paid when due, from the date such amount shall be due until such amount shall be paid in full, payable in arrears on the date such amount shall be paid in full and on demand, at a rate per annum equal at all times to 2% per annum above the rate per annum required to be paid on Base Rate Advances pursuant to clause (a)(i) above, provided, however, that following acceleration of the Advances pursuant to Section 6.01, Default Interest shall accrue and be payable hereunder whether or not previously required by the Agent.
SECTION 2.08. Interest Rate Determination. (a) The Agent shall give prompt notice to the Borrower and the Lenders of the applicable interest rate determined by the Agent for purposes of Section 2.07(a)(i) or (ii).
(b)    If, with respect to any Eurodollar Rate Advances, the Required Lenders notify the Agent that the Eurodollar Rate for any Interest Period for such Advances will not adequately reflect the cost to such Required Lenders of making, funding or maintaining their respective Eurodollar Rate Advances for such Interest Period, the Agent shall forthwith so notify the Borrower and the Lenders, whereupon (i) each Eurodollar Rate Advance will automatically, on the last day of the then existing Interest Period therefor, Convert into a Base Rate Advance, and (ii) the obligation of the Lenders to make, or to Convert Advances into, Eurodollar Rate Advances shall be suspended until the Agent shall notify the Borrower and the Lenders that the circumstances causing such suspension no longer exist.
(c)    If the Borrower shall fail to provide notice of a Conversion or continuation pursuant to Section 2.09 for any Eurodollar Rate Advance, then the Agent will forthwith so notify the Borrower and the Lenders and the Borrower will be deemed to have selected an Interest Period of one month for such Eurodollar Rate Advance.
(d)    On the date on which the aggregate unpaid principal amount of Eurodollar Rate Advances comprising any Borrowing shall be reduced, by payment or prepayment or otherwise, to less than $10,000,000, such Advances shall automatically Convert into Base Rate Advances.
(e)    Upon the occurrence and during the continuance of any Event of Default under Section 6.01(a), and if the Agent, at the request, or with the consent, of the Required Lenders, so notifies the Borrower, then: (i) each Eurodollar Rate Advance will automatically, on the last day of the then existing Interest Period therefor, Convert into a Base Rate Advance and (ii) the obligation of the Lenders to make, or to Convert Advances into, Eurodollar Rate Advances shall be suspended.
(f)    If Reuters Screen LIBOR01 Page is unavailable,
(i)    the Agent shall forthwith notify the Borrower and the Lenders that the interest rate cannot be determined for such Eurodollar Rate Advances,
(ii)    with respect to Eurodollar Rate Advances, each such Advance will automatically, on the last day of the then existing Interest Period therefor, Convert into a Base Rate Advance (or if such Advance is then a Base Rate Advance, will continue as a Base Rate Advance), and

27



(iii)    the obligation of the Lenders to make Eurodollar Rate Advances or to Convert Advances into Eurodollar Rate Advances shall be suspended until the Agent shall notify the Borrower and the Lenders that the circumstances causing such suspension no longer exist.
SECTION 2.09. Optional Conversion and Continuation of Advances. The Borrower may on any Business Day, upon notice given to the Agent not later than 11:00 A.M. (New York City time) on the third Business Day prior to the date of the proposed Conversion or continuation and subject to the provisions of Sections 2.08 and 2.12, Convert all Advances of one Type comprising the same Borrowing into Advances of the other Type or continue all or any part of any Eurodollar Rate Advance constituting the same Borrowing; provided, however, that any Conversion of Eurodollar Rate Advances into Base Rate Advances shall be made only on the last day of an Interest Period for such Eurodollar Rate Advances, any Conversion of Base Rate Advances into Eurodollar Rate Advances shall be in an amount not less than the minimum amount specified in Section 2.02(b) and no Conversion of any Advances shall result in more separate Borrowings than permitted under Section 2.02(b). Each such notice of a Conversion or continuation shall, within the restrictions specified above, specify (i) the date of such Conversion or continuation, (ii) the Advances to be Converted or continued, and (iii) if such Conversion or continuation is into Eurodollar Rate Advances, the duration of the Interest Period for each such Advance. Each notice of Conversion shall be irrevocable and binding on the Borrower.
SECTION 2.10. Optional Prepayments of Advances. The Borrower may at any time, and from time to time, without premium or penalty, upon notice at least three Business Days prior to the date of such prepayment, in the case of Eurodollar Rate Advances, and not later than 11:00 A.M. (New York City time) on the date of such prepayment, in the case of Base Rate Advances, to the Agent stating the proposed date and aggregate principal amount of the prepayment, and if such notice is given the Borrower shall prepay the outstanding principal amount of the Advances comprising part of the same Borrowing in whole or ratably in part, together with accrued interest to the date of such prepayment on the principal amount prepaid; provided, however, that (x) each partial prepayment shall be in an aggregate principal amount of $10,000,000 or an integral multiple of $1,000,000 in excess thereof and (y) in the event of any such prepayment of a Eurodollar Rate Advance, the Borrower shall be obligated to reimburse the Lenders in respect thereof pursuant to Section 8.04(e). Notwithstanding the foregoing, any such notice of prepayment may state that such notice is conditioned upon the effectiveness of any other transaction or event, in which case such notice may, subject to Section 8.04(e), be revoked by the Borrower (by notice to the Agent on or prior to the specified effective date) if such condition is not satisfied.

SECTION 5.03. Financial Covenant. So long as any Advance shall remain unpaid, any Letter of Credit is outstanding or any Lender shall have any Commitment hereunder, the Borrower will not permit the Consolidated Interest Coverage Ratio as of the last day of any fiscal quarter to be less than 3.00 to 1.00.

SECTION 6.01. Events of Default. If any of the following events (“Events of Default”) shall occur and be continuing:
(a)    The Borrower shall fail to pay any principal of any Advance when the same becomes due and payable; or the Borrower shall fail to pay any interest on any Advance or make any other payment of fees or other amounts payable under this Agreement or any Note (if any) within five Business Days after the same becomes due and payable; or
(b)    Any representation or warranty made by the Borrower herein or in connection with this Agreement shall prove to have been incorrect in any material respect when made; or
(c)    (i) The Borrower shall fail to perform or observe any term, covenant or agreement contained in Section 5.01(d) (as to the existence of the Borrower) or (h)(iii), 5.02 or 5.03, (ii) the Borrower shall fail to perform or observe any term, covenant or agreement contained in Section 5.01(h)(i) or (h)(ii) if such failure shall remain unremedied for five days after written notice thereof shall have been given to the Borrower by the Agent; or (ii) the Borrower shall fail to perform or observe any other term, covenant or agreement contained in this Agreement on its part to be performed or observed if such failure shall remain unremedied for 30 days after written notice thereof shall have been given to the Borrower by the Agent; or
(d)    (i) The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ries shall fail to pay any principal of or premium or interest on any Debt that is outstanding in a principal amount of at least $500,000,000 in the aggregate (but excluding Debt outstanding hereunder and Debt under Hedge Agreements) of the Borrower or such Subsidiary (as the case may be), when the same becomes due and payable (whether by scheduled maturity, required prepayment, acceleration, demand or otherwise), and such failure (i) shall continue after the applicable grace period, if any, specified in the agreement or instrument relating to such Debt and (ii) shall not have been cured or waived; or any other event shall occur or condition shall exist under any agreement or instrument relating to any such Debt and shall continue after the applicable grace period, if any, specified in such agreement or instrument, if the effect of such event or condition is to accelerate the maturity of such Debt; or any such Debt shall be declared to be due and payable, or required to be prepaid or redeemed (other than by a regularly scheduled required prepayment or redemption, or, with respect to any secured Debt, resulting from a disposition, condemnation, insured loss or similar event relating to the property securing such Debt), purchased or defeased, or an offer to prepay, redeem, purchase or defease such Debt shall be required to be made, in each case prior to the stated maturity thereof or (ii) there occurs under any Hedge Agreement an Early Termination Date (as defined in such Hedge Agreement) resulting from (A) any event of default under such Hedge Agreement as to which the Borrower or any Subsidiary is the Defaulting Party (as defined in such Hedge Agreement) or (B) any Termination Event (as so defined) under such Hedge Agreement as to which the Borrower or any Subsidiary is an Affected Party (as so defined) and, in either event, the Termination Value owed by the Borrower or such Subsidiary as a result thereof is at least $500,000,000; or
(e)    The Borrower or any of its Material Subsidiaries shall generally not pay its debts as such debts become due, or shall admit in writing its inability to pay its debts generally, or shall make a general assignment for the benefit of creditors; or any proceeding shall be instituted by or against the Borrower or any of its Material Subsidiaries seeking to adjudicate it a bankrupt or insolvent, or seeking liquidation, winding up, reorganization, arrangement, adjustment, protection, relief, or composition of it or its debts under any law relating to bankruptcy, insolvency or reorganization or relief of debtors, or seeking the entry of an order for relief or the appointment of a receiver, trustee, custodian or other similar official for it or for any substantial

49



part of its property and, in the case of any such proceeding instituted against it (but not instituted by it), either such proceeding shall remain undismissed or unstayed for a period of 60 days, or any of the actions sought in such proceeding (including, without limitation, the entry of an order for relief against, or the appointment of a receiver, trustee, custodian or other similar official for, it or for any substantial part of its property) shall occur; or the Borrower or any of its Material Subsidiaries shall take any corporate action to authorize any of the actions set forth above in this subsection (e); or
(f)    Final judgments or orders for the payment of money in excess of $500,000,000 in the aggregate (to the extent not paid or covered by independent third-party insurance as to which the insurer does not dispute coverage) shall be rendered against the Borrower or any of its Subsidiaries and either (i) enforcement proceedings shall have been commenced by any creditor upon such judgment or order or (ii) the same shall remain undischarged for any period of 60 consecutive days during which a stay of enforcement of such judgment or order, by reason of a pending appeal or otherwise, shall not be in effect; or
(g)    The Borrower or any of its ERISA Affiliates shall incur, or could reasonably be expected to incur, liability in excess of $500,000,000 in the aggregate as a result of one or more of the following: (i) the occurrence of any ERISA Event; (ii) the partial or complete withdrawal of the Borrower or any of its ERISA Affiliates from a Multiemployer Plan; or (iii) the reorganization or termination of a Multiemployer Plan or a determination has been made that a Multiemployer Plan is in “endangered” or “critical” status within the meaning of Section 432 of the Code or Section 305 of ERISA;
then, and in any such event, the Agent (i) shall at the request, or may with the consent, of the Required Lenders, by notice to the Borrower, declare the obligation of each Lender to make Advances (other than Advances to be made by a Lender pursuant to Section 2.02(b) or by an Issuing Bank or a Lender pursuant to Section 2.03(c)) and of the Issuing Banks to issue Letters of Credit to be terminated, whereupon the same shall forthwith terminate, and (ii) shall at the request, or may with the consent, of the Required Lenders, by notice to the Borrower, declare the Advances, all interest thereon and all other amounts payable under this Agreement to be forthwith due and payable, whereupon the Advances, all such interest and all such amounts shall become and be forthwith due and payable, without presentment, demand, protest or further notice of any kind, all of which are hereby expressly waived by the Borrower; provided, however, that in the event of an actual or deemed entry of an order for relief with respect to the Borrower under the Federal Bankruptcy Code, (A) the obligation of each Lender to make Advances (other than Advances to be made by a Lender pursuant to Section 2.02(b) or by an Issuing Bank or a Lender pursuant to Section 2.03(c)) and of the Issuing Banks to issue Letters of Credit shall automatically be terminated and (B) the Advances, all such interest and all such amounts shall automatically become and be due and payable, without presentment, demand, protest or any notice of any kind, all of which are hereby expressly waived by the Borrower.
